Taking panorama pictures (Panorama Shot Mode)
Recording Mode:
Pictures are recorded continuously while moving the camera horizontally or vertically, and are
combined to make a single panorama picture.
This mode allows you to add any of 13 types of effects before recording.
1
Set the mode dial to [ ].
2
Press 3/4 to select the recording direction and then
press [MENU/SET].
3
Press 3/4 to select image effects and then press [MENU/SET].
You can add the same image effect as the Creative Control Mode with the same operation as
the Creative Control Mode.
(except for [Toy Effect] and [Miniature Effect]) (P6973)
During panorama picture recording, the following image effect of the Creative Control Mode
is not visible on the screen:
[Star Filter]
If you are not going to add an image effect, select [No Effect].
4
After confirming the recording direction, press [MENU/SET].
If the selected recording direction is the same as that of the previous recording, the screen
that lets you check the recording direction may not be displayed.
A horizontal/vertical guide is displayed.
If you press 1, you will return to step
2.
5
Press the shutter button halfway to focus.
